The latest major version for God Eater 3 on Nintendo Switch is Ver. 2.50, which served as the final content update for the game. This update, along with previous 2.x versions, significantly expanded the endgame with new story arcs, high-difficulty missions, and character customization. ⚔️ New Story: "Traversing the Past"

This free DLC-style update series adds deep background lore for your AI companions. Final Episode: Episode Ein was added in Ver. 2.50.

Previous Episodes: Individual story arcs for Hugo, Zeke, Phym, Keith, and Neal were introduced in earlier 2.x patches.

Unlockables: Completing these episodes raises the equipment upgrade cap (God Arc "+" level) up to +60. New Aragami & Missions

Updates introduced several powerful "Ashwrought" variants that offer unique crafting materials.

Ashwrought Balmung Regalia: A high-speed, deadly variant added in Ver. 2.50.

Tyranny Hannibal: Added in Ver. 2.40 for a supreme combat challenge.

Crimson Ashland Missions: Highly difficult missions with shifting ash anomalies that grant a better drop rate for +2 Abandoned God Arcs. god eater 3 switch nsp update dlc new

Certification & Time Attack: New missions added (Cert. 47–50 and Time Attack EX27–EX30) for veteran players. 🛠️ Key Gameplay Features

God Arc Blueprints: New weapons for Short Blade, Boost Hammer, and Heavy Moon can be crafted using materials from Balmung Regalia. Balance Adjustments:

Long Blade: Speed buff for the "Zero Stance" to Square/Triangle combo.

Mobility: All God Arcs can now chain "Aerial Attack → Dive → Aerial Attack" for better air time.

Jukebox Tracks: New music tracks added to the base's jukebox. 👕 Customization & Cosmetics

The update includes a massive influx of free "DLC" cosmetics:

New Outfits: "Noble" series (Tango, Waltz, Ballet, Bolero) and various Academy/Institute uniforms for both male and female avatars. The latest major version for God Eater 3

Accessory Slots: New items like the Mustache, Silver Tiara, and Golden Crown (unlocked via gold medals in Time Attack).

Character Remake: Players can now fully reset their character's appearance, including gender, via the "Remake" feature.
